[SCU - Points2] Gallbladder (Locations)
Question | Answer |
---|---|
GB1 | 0.5 cun lateral to the outer canthus, in the depression on the lateral side of the orbit. |
GB2 | Anterior to the intertragic notch, at the posterior border of the condyloid process of the mandible. The point is located with the mouth open. |
GB3 | In the front of the ear, on the upper border of the zygomatic arch, in the depression directly above Xiaguan (ST-7). |
GB4 | Within the hairline of the temporal region, at the junction of the upper 1/4 and lower 3/4 of the distance between Touwei (ST-8) and Qubin (GB-7). |
GB5 | Within the hairline of the temporal region, midway of the border line connecting Touwei (ST-8) and Qubin (GB-7). |
GB6 | Within the hairline, at the junction of the lower 1/4 and upper 3/4 of the distance between Touwei (ST-8) and Qubin (GB-7). |
GB7 | On the head, at a crossing point of the vertical posterior border of the temple and horizontal line through the ear apex. |
GB8 | Superior to the apex of the auricle, 1.5 cun within the hairline. |
GB9 | Directly above the posterior border of the auricle, 2 cun within the hairline, about 0.5 cun posterior to Shuaigu (GB-8). |
GB10 | Posterior and superior to the mastoid process, at the junction of the middle third and upper third of the curve line connecting Tianchong (GB-9) and Wangu (GB-12). |
GB11 | Posterior and superior to the mastoid process, at the junction of middle third and lower third of the curved line connecting Tianchong (GB-9) and Wangu (GB-12). |
GB12 | In the depression posterior and inferior to the mastoid process. |
GB13 | 0.5 cun within the hairline of the forehead, 3 cun lateral to Shenting (DU-24). |
GB14 | On the forehead, directly above the pupil, 1 cun directly above the midpoint of the eyebrow. |
GB15 | On the head, directly above the pupil and 0.5 cun above the anterior hairline, at the midpoint of the line connecting Shenting (GV 24) and Touwei (ST 8). |
GB16 | On the head, 1.5 cun above the anterior hairline and 2.25 cun lateral to the midline of the head. |
GB17 | On the head, 2.5 cun above the anterior hairline and 2.25 cun lateral to the midline of the head. |
GB18 | On the head, 4 cun above the anterior hairline and 2.25 cun lateral to the midline of the head. |
GB19 | On the head and on the level of the upper border of external occipital protuberance or Naohu (DU-17), 2.25 cun lateral to the midline of the head. |
GB20 | In the depression between the upper portion of m. sternocleidomastoideus and m. trapezius, on the same level with Fengfu (GV 16).. |
GB21 | On the shoulder, directly above the nipple, at the midpoint of the line connecting Dazhui (DU-14) and the acromion, at the highest point of the shoulder. |
GB22 | On the mid-axillary line when the arm is raised, 3 cun below the axilla, in the 4th intercostal space. |
GB23 | 1 cun anterior to Yuanye (GB 22), at the level of the nipple, in the 4th intercostal space. |
GB24 | Directly below the nipple, in the seventh intercostal space, 4 cun lateral to the anterior midline. |
GB25 | On the lateral side of the abdomen, on the lower border of the free end of the twelfth rib. |
GB26 | Directly below Zhangmen (LR 13), at the crossing point of a vertical line through the free end of the eleventh rib and a horizontal line through the umbilicus. |
GB27 | In the lateral side of the abdomen, anterior to the superior iliac spine, 3 cun below the level of the umbilicus. |
GB28 | Anterior and inferior to the anterior superior iliac spine, 0.5 cun anterior and inferior to Wushu (GB-27). |
GB29 | In the depression of the midpoint between the anterosuperior iliac spine and the prominence of the great trochanter. |
GB30 | At the junction of the lateral 1/3 and medial 2/3 of the distance between the prominence of the great trochanter and the hiatus of the sacrum (Yaoshu, GV 2). When locating the point, put the patient in lateral recumbent position with the thigh flexed. |
GB31 | On the midline of the lateral aspect of the thigh, 7 cun above the transverse popliteal crease. When the patient is standing erect with the hands close to the sides, the point is where the tip of the middle finger touches. |
GB32 | On the lateral aspect of the thigh, 2 cun below Fengshi (GB-31), or 5 cun above the transverse popliteal crease, between m. vastus lateralis and m. biceps femoris. |
GB33 | 3 cun above Yangliangquan (GB-34), lateral to the knee joint, in the depression above the external epicondyle of femur. |
GB34 | In the depression anterior and inferior to the head of the fibula. |
GB35 | In the depression anterior and inferior to the head of the fibula. |
GB36 | 7 cun above the tip of the external malleolus, on the anterior border of the fibula. |
GB37 | 5 cun directly above the tip of the external malleolus, on the anterior border of the fibula. |
GB38 | 4 cun above the tip of the external malleolus, slightly anterior to the anterior border of the fibula, between m. extensor digitorum longus and m. peronaeus brevis. |
GB39 | 3 cun above the tip of the external malleolus, on the anterior border of fibula. |
GB40 | Anterior and inferior to the external malleolus, in the depression on the lateral side of the tendon of m. extensor digitorum longus. |
GB41 | Posterior to the fourth metatarsophalangeal joint, in the depression lateral to the tendon of m. extensor digiti minimi of the foot. |
GB42 | Posterior to the fourth metatarsophalangeal joint, between the fourth and fifth metatarsal bones, on the medial side of the tendon of m. extensor digiti minimi of foot. |
GB43 | On the dorsum of foot, between the fourth and fifth toe, proximal to the margin of the web, at the junction of the red and white skin. |
GB44 | On the lateral side of the fourth toe, about 0.1 cun from the corner of the nail. |
